If you've got a bit of extra time try it this way. butterfly the chicken breast, put butter and bacon or whatever else you want in it. fold it all up then fold it tightly into and with plastic wrap. make it look like a big pill! then freeze that for a couple of hours. Take it out of the cling wrap and its a hard bullet that you can easily flour, egg and bread without it all flopping around on you. It also keeps in the butter and goodness soo much better. It also makes the frying easy. If you have a deep fryer, do it in there just to brown, then into the oven. A chef taught me this long ago and I find even in a good deep freeze for half hour makes it so much easier to handle and bread nicely.
